  • Display freaking out, flashing, fan spinning

    Hello all. My MBP (from about February/March) just suddenly started flashing the display when I got home today - a regular, pulsing, strobe-like flashing that makes it impossible to look at it. The fan also starts spinning like crazy, though I wouldn't say the computer seems hotter than usual.
    I have rebooted, booted off the start disks, unplugged everything and rebooted again - nothing makes any difference. Trying to go to Displays in System Preferences just hangs.
    I'm writing this on an external monitor at the moment, which is behaving fine, so it's something about the laptop itself. I have an appt tomorrow at the Genius Bar but I'm freaking out because I have a deadline for some work... does anyone have any ideas? It does look like a hardware thing...

    Have you tried running the Apple Hardware Test? It's on Install Disc #1 of the gray discs that came with your computer. I don't know if you can run it given the way your computer is acting up, but if you can run it, you may get an error code which would point towards the cause of the problem.
    Also, if you can, open Activity Monitor (in your Utilities folder in your Applications folder). Select "All Processes" at the top, and see if you have something running amok in the background that is hogging the CPU. This is something that would cause the fans to spin like crazy.
    There is a "Flash Screen" option under the Hearing tab in Universal access, but I don't think that this is the problem here. You could check to see that it is turned off.
    Since the problem persists even when booted from a disc, I suspect it is a hardware problem.
    Do be sure you have an up to date backup before going in--there's a good chance your Mac will have to go off to be repaired.

    Hi, Adam -
    To use the keyboard to empty the Trash, press Command-Shift-Delete (that's the large Delete button two rows above Return).
    Normally, to delete a locked item when emptying the Trash, one would press Option while selecting Empty Trash from the Special menu. However, adding Option to the Command-Shift-Delete combo does not seem to work (just tested it).
    If the issue is indeed software based, it should not be at play when the machine is booted to an OS Install CD. That's one of the reasons to boot to a CD - all software on the hard drive becomes nothing more than data files; none of it is in use.
    One of the main causes for such behavior when using an Apple Pro mouse is that those mouses had a defect - the wires inside the cable could fray at the point the cable leaves the mouse body, causing random open or short circuits.
    Another possible cause occurs when an optical mouse overloads the non-powered hub in the keyboard. This happened to me - it finally killed the keyboard. After replacing the keyboard I came across Apple KBase Article #58649 - Apple Pro Keyboard: Devices Connected. I reconfigured my USB connection scheme so that the mouse was plugged into the powered hub in my monitor, and have not had a similar problem since.

    enmanneleu wrote:
    Charles Minow wrote:
    One more thing I didn't think of before: what kind of keyboard do you have?
    An apple keyboard. The new thin one with wire.
    I have now tried the tablet on another computer (PC) and it worked but the LED on it flickered. Maybe because it did not get power enough? But I don't understand how this affects the keyboard?
    Because the tablet and keyboard are both USB devices, there are certain things they share in common. Both are electrical devices connected to the same bus on the computer. And there would be a certain amount of commonality between their data paths once the electrical signals reach the computer. When you push a key on your keyboard, it sends an electrical signal to the computer that Mac OS X interprets as a key press. The tablet also sends electrical information to the computer, it's just interpreted differently by the computer.
    This is a vastly oversimplified explanation, but suppose the keyboard sends its signals to the computer and identifies itself as USB device 1 and the tablet identifies itself as USB device 2. But the actual content of the signals each sends is pretty much the same, just data that represents a series of numbers. It's really important, then, for OS X to be able to distinguish between them, because the signal from the keyboard for pressing the letter "a" might be the same as the signal from the tablet when you click at a pixel 20 in from the left and 67 in from the top, with a pressure of 50%.
    So, how would OS X be confused between the keyboard and tablet? It could happen for an electrical reason. For example, only part of the data from the tablet or keyboard gets to the computer, but enough that OS X can at least try to interpret it. Or, once the data gets from the tablet or keyboard, the software that listens to the USB devices tells OS X the wrong thing about the information it received. Each USB device has an associated driver that interprets the signals from that device and tells OS X what to do. There could be a bug in a driver that would take the signal from Device 2 (the tablet) and assume it came from Device 1 (keyboard), and then send OS X the wrong information. But I think it's less likely to be a keyboard driver bug if you use the default Apple driver, which you'd use with one of their keyboards.
    The LED on the tablet flickering makes it sound like a problem in the tablet itself or with its USB cable, and not a problem with the software on your Mac. If you know someone else with a tablet who could let you borrow theirs for a short time, that would also be helpful. If their tablet works, and doesn't interfere with the keyboard, then you know it's more likely to be the tablet itself and not your computer.
    One other thing is to move the keyboard and tablet to different USB ports on your iMac. I think you have four to choose from, right? Perhaps there's something wrong with one of the ports on the computer, a bent pin or maybe a piece of dust that's causing a connection not to be made.
